The overview below groups typical Damaged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Leeds,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- Damaged roof repairs typically range from $300 to $1,500 depending on the extent of the damage. Minor fixes like replacing shingles may cost around $300 to $800, while more extensive repairs can reach up to $1,500 or more.
Material Expenses - The cost of materials for damaged roof repairs varies based on the type of roofing. Asphalt shingles might cost between $100 and $300 per square, whereas metal or tile materials can increase costs significantly.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for roof repairs generally fall between $50 and $150 per hour. The total labor expense depends on the repair complexity and the size of the damaged area.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may include debris removal, which can add $100 to $300, and permits or inspections that might range from $50 to $200. Overall costs depend on the specific repair requirements and local cont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of roof damage? Visible issues such as missing shingles, leaks, water stains on ceilings, or damaged flashing can indicate roof damage that may require repair.
How do professionals repair a damaged roof? Local roofing contractors typically assess the extent of damage, then perform repairs such as replacing shingles, fixing leaks, or restoring damaged structural components.
Can damaged roofs be repaired or do they need replacement? Many roof damages can be repaired, but severe or extensive damage might necessitate a full roof replacement. A professional assessment can determine the best course of action.
How long do roof repairs usually take? The duration of roof repairs varies depending on the extent of the dam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days following an inspection.
